Schaub Colonial appliance pull is an appliance pull from Schaub and Company in the Colonial style that provides a consistent gripping point on appliance panels. The 12 inch center-to-center measurement sets a wide, stable hand span that helps move heavier doors smoothly. The satin brass finish defines the visual look of the pull, supporting projects that call for a warm metal tone on visible appliance fronts. Being part of Schaub decorative hardware and moldings keeps this pull aligned with other handles and pulls from the same design family. The Schaub and Company branding identifies a specific source, which matters when matching existing Colonial hardware on a replacement or expansion job. The appliance pull format distinguishes this part from shorter cabinet pulls, helping it suit tall or wide appliance panels.
The 12 inch center-to-center dimension fixes the distance between mounting points, guiding drilling so the pull seats level across an appliance panel. This spacing supports installations on wider doors where a longer pull helps distribute hand force. The 1/4"-20 thread size defines how the pull connects to the panel, so the mounting bolts engage cleanly with the pull body during tightening. This standard thread type supports repeatable fastening across multiple units on the same job. The satin brass finish covers the exposed surfaces of the pull, so once mounted, the visible hardware presents a uniform metal tone across the front of the appliance.
